Middle English Dictionary Entry
dēpōst n.
Entry Info
Forms | dēpōst n. |
Etymology | OF |
Definitions (Senses and Subsenses)
1.
A thing entrusted for safekeeping; -- used fig.
Associated quotations
- (c1384) WBible(1) (Dc 369(2))1 Tim.6.20 : Thou Tymothe, kepe the depoost [L depositum], or thing bitakun to thee, eschewinge curside noueltees of voyces, and opynyouns of fals name of kunnyng.
- (c1384) WBible(1) (Dc 369(2))2 Tim.1.12 : He is myȝti for to kepe my depoost, or thing putt in keping, into that day.
